Most Rose teas at the Chinese grocery store, or really any grocery store has been sitting on the shelf too long and thus are no longer flavorful. Thus, it is more important to buy flower teas from fresher sources even if the price is higher. Rose teas and chrysanthemum teas are big examples of flowers gone stale and old at a store, so I recommend buying your rose and flower teas online. When you open this package, it smells bright and lovely and the colors are so bright that they almost look like freshly plucked roses. Most roses at the store are paler and staler in color.This tea smells nice- almost makes you want to take some shower with rose petals afterward when you breathe it in. You just need a small handful and hot water and the smell is lovely. There should only be a slight tang to it b/c of the Vitamin C that is packed in roses, but if it's just straight up sour, then you know you have a bad batch of rose tea (not in the case of this company here- but you get that sour quality with many grocery stores). Let it steep for a few mins- it's ok for flower teas to steep longer than leaf and herbal teas b/c they can't become too bitter.Drink this on a summer day for something bright, delicate, but romantic smelling.
